Stanford's 'Baby Bonus' trial: can cash and coaches build healthier futures?
Prevention Recruiting nowThis study is testing whether providing new families with extra money and a community health worker helps them use important health and social services and supports their child's healthy development. Ambulance video link could save Kids' lives in pakistan
Knowledge-focused Recruiting nowThis study tests whether connecting an ambulance to a remote children's emergency doctor via a simple video call can improve care for seriously ill children in low-resource settings. 24,000 moms and kids join landmark study on early health origins
Knowledge-focused Recruiting nowThis study looks at how things that happen early in life—like pregnancy complications or birth outcomes—can affect health later for both mothers and children. New study aims to save thousands of kids from TB in africa
Knowledge-focused Recruiting nowThis study will test new decision-making tools to help doctors at district hospitals and health centers in Mozambique and Zambia better diagnose and treat tuberculosis (TB) in children.
